St John's CofE Primary School
Church Street, Pemberton, Wigan WN5 0DT
St John's CofE Primary School is a Church of England primary school maintained by the local authority (Wigan). It has about 200 boys and girls aged between 4 and 11. In May 2023 the school was rated ‘Good’ by Ofsted.
Particular strengths include Progress, Disadvantaged pupils, Attainment and Representation. Relative weaknesses include Attendance and Environment.

Progress: Excellent. Progress in maths, reading and writing are all excellent. (This takes into account pupils' prior performance. For actual grades, see Attainment.)
Disadvantaged pupils: Excellent. Progress in maths is above average. Progress in reading is excellent. Progress in writing is excellent.
Attainment: Above average. Maths attainment is above average, reading is above average and GPS (grammar, punctuation and spelling) is about average. (This doesn't take into account pupils' prior performance. For that, see Progress.)
Representation: In balance. The socio-economic mix is slightly out of balance with the local community, while ethnic representation is in balance with the local community. Show details
Finances: About average. The school budget has been roughly in balance
Admissions: About average. The occupancy rate is roughly average.
Environment: Below average. Air pollution and traffic accidents are quite low, while crime is very high.
Attendance: Poor. Pupil absence rates and the incidence of persistent absence are both very high.
